What did the watson-crick model suggest about the replication of dna?

Respuesta :

JhoMelKing
JhoMelKing JhoMelKing
  • 26-07-2018

The answer to this question is DNA replicates by a template mechanism or should have a replication machine. Watson and Crick suggested that all organisms must reproduce their DNA with exceptional correctness before each cell division.
